Moxico: FAA told to master new technologies
Luena, ANGOLA, November 10 - Members with the Angolan Armed Forces (FAA), stationed in the Eastern Military Region, have been encouraged to master the computing and new technologies emerging in society.

The appeal was launched Friday by the chief of Staff of the eastern region, António Jorge dos Santos "Tojo".
The high ranking officer of FAA said so during a lecture on the historical dimension of November 11, 1975", to mark the 42nd anniversary of National Independence.
In his speech, he explained that the new technologies are important tools that contribute to the development of the country.
The chief of Staff urged for the need to focus on academic and technical-professional training.
Over four hundred FAA members attended the lecture.
